x
Close

Xoli Mj

Christian/Gospel / Contemporary rock Johannesburg, GP, ZA   ZA ... more

Xoli Mj

Christian/Gospel / Contemporary rock Johannesburg, GP, ZA   ZA

Xoli Mj

Christian/Gospel / Contemporary rock Johannesburg, GP, ZA   ZA ... more

Xoli Mj

Christian/Gospel / Contemporary rock Johannesburg, GP, ZA   ZA